There is no treatment or cure, but children that are diagnosed at an earlier age have more positive outcomes.Early diagnosis also helps family members and teachers understand the reactions and behavior of the FAS child, which can differ widely from other children in the same situations. It has been found that children who recieve special education for their specific needs and learning abilities are more likely to achieve their developmental goals.
